Alan Flood


10 January, 6-8pm

Alan Flood was born in Blackburn, where he studied at Blackburn School of Art and School of Fine Art, and then later at Leeds Polytechnic. After a successful career as an illustrator he began painting again in 1987.

Fast-forward twenty years and Flood is a highly-regarded and accomplished portrait painter; the Russian violinist, Marat Bisengaliev, the conductor Paul Daniel, Sir Ernest Hall OBE, the guitarist John Renbourn, and the late Jane Tomlinson have sat for him.

Brahm Gallery is pleased to be exhibiting a collection of Alan Flood’s paintings made over the last 3 years, including portraiture, still life, landscape and striking works from his prominent ‘Koi’ series.
